Flathead Lake is a magnificent natural freshwater lake nestled in the scenic Flathead Valley of northwest Montana, United States. At an elevation of approximately 887 meters (2,910 feet), it holds the distinction of being the largest natural freshwater lake by surface area west of the Mississippi River in the contiguous United States.     Are there any specific biking routes or scenic drives recommended around Flathead Lake?

    Yes, both U.S. Route 93 on the west side and Route 35 on the east side offer incredibly scenic drives with breathtaking views of the lake and surrounding mountains. These routes are also popular for road cycling, though cyclists should be mindful of traffic, especially during peak season. For off-road biking, nearby state forests and recreation areas may offer suitable trails. The 185 miles of shoreline provide ample opportunities for exploring by car or bike.

    What unique natural features or landmarks should I look out for at Flathead Lake?

    Beyond its exceptional clarity and vastness, Flathead Lake is notable for its numerous islands, with Wild Horse Island being the largest and most prominent. This island is a state park accessible by boat and is home to wild horses and bighorn sheep. The lake itself is a remnant of the ancient glacial Lake Missoula, giving it a unique geological history. The surrounding Mission Mountains to the east and Salish Mountains to the west also contribute to its dramatic natural backdrop.

    What are the requirements for accessing the southern half of Flathead Lake, which is part of the Flathead Indian Reservation?

    The southern half of Flathead Lake falls within the Flathead Indian Reservation. For any recreational activities in this area, including fishing, boating, or hiking, a tribal recreation permit is required. These permits help support the Confederated Salish and Kootenai Tribes, who have owned and operated the hydroelectric facility at the lake's outlet since 2015.

    What kind of wildlife can I expect to see around Flathead Lake, especially on Wild Horse Island?

    Flathead Lake and its surroundings are rich in wildlife. Anglers can find trout, whitefish, and pikeminnow in the lake. On Wild Horse Island, visitors have the unique opportunity to observe wild horses, bighorn sheep, deer, and various bird species. Along the lake's shores and in nearby forests, you might also spot bald eagles, ospreys, and other waterfowl, as well as larger mammals like elk and bears, particularly in more secluded areas.
